Mvvm 画面遷移 ビヘイビア
WebMar 15, 2014 · 添付ビヘイビアを使って、任意のコマンド呼び出しを行う. 以前、↓で書いたRelayCommandですが、これはCommandプロパティを持つコントロールでしか使用できません。. RelayCommandをバインドできるのは、↓みたいにCommandプロパティを持っているButtonなどのような ... WebAug 23, 2010 · まずは、簡単なビヘイビアからです。. ビヘイビアは、System.Windows.Interactivity.Behavior 型を継承して作ります。. Tは、ビヘイビアを適 …
Mvvm 画面遷移 ビヘイビア
Did you know?
WebApr 5, 2014 · mvvmな設計でアプリを作るときの、よくある悩みとして、 vmから画面を閉じる処理をどうやればいいんだ?? というのがあります。これって、添付ビヘイビア … http://yujiro15.net/YKSoftware/tips_Behavior.html
WebAug 14, 2009 · スキルがついてけてないのですが、MVVMでは、Commandを利用して、イベントを処理していくのですが、. 画面に対する制御、例えば、CheckboxにCheckが入ったときに、他のTextBoxをDisableにするなどの処理を行う場合、. behaviorを定義して、制御することは調べて ... WebJun 29, 2024 · 試したこと1. ページ2のコードビハインドにNavigationService.LoadCompletedイベントで設定したパラメータを取得。. (MVVMで実装したいため、最終的にはViewModelでNavigationService.LoadCompletedの実装を行いたいが方法が、. わからなかったためテストとしてコード ...
Web1 Answer. Sorted by: 9. You can do this with a behavior, a simple solution wouldn't involve the VM at all: public static class ScrollToSelectedBehavior { public static readonly DependencyProperty SelectedValueProperty = DependencyProperty.RegisterAttached ( "SelectedValue", typeof (object), typeof (ScrollToSelectedBehavior), new ... WebOct 15, 2015 · WPFのListBoxでMVVM的なイベント追加をしたいと思っています。 そこで、ListBoxのアイテムにダブルクリックイベントをCommandを使用して追加しました。 以下の様な形で実装できたのですが、もう少しコンパクトな形にできないでしょうか? ・ItemsSourceを使用する ・ListBoxのアイテム行のどこをダブル ...
WebApr 20, 2016 · ViewModel から画面遷移できない!. MVVM でアプリを作るうえで、画面遷移は ViewModel 主体で(もしその先にアプリ全体を管理するモデルがあるのであればそこでコントロール)したいと考えます。. 公式ドキュメントにも MVVM に触れた記載 はあるものの、所詮 ...
Webtips - 添付ビヘイビアを作成する 添付ビヘイビアとは、既存のコントロールに後付けで新たに添付することができ、 特定のイベントに対する振る舞いを定義することができるものです。 サンプルプロジェクトはここからダウンロードできます。 l.e. black phillips funeral homeWebFeb 6, 2024 · ビヘイビアとは. 言葉の意味は「振る舞い」。WPFでMVVMに準拠する際、Viewの状態の変化をきっかけにして、Viewで実行される処理の実装方法のことを指す。MVVMに準拠するとコードビハインドが使えないので、その代替手段ということになる。 … how to drink red wineWebビヘイビア、トリガー、アクションの詳細については以下の記事をどうぞ。. the sea of fertility: MVVMパターンでViewModelからViewを操作したい. 続いてViewModelを説明 … how to drink purified water in rlcraftWebApr 6, 2014 · mvvm界隈でよく話題になっている、「vmからviewに指示をしたい」という時の定番ネタ。 vmからダイアログを開く方法を添付ビヘイビアで作ってみました。↓の記事を参考に作ってみました。 トロこんぶ: 「mvvmでダイアログ表示のためにメッセンジャーを使用するのはおかしいのでは? how to drink pure white hennessyWebただ、MVVM(Model-View-ViewModel)パターンを採用する場合、なるべくコードビハインドは汚したくありません。. ここではコードビハインドを使わずにページを遷移させ … le black hole lyonWebApr 3, 2024 · Behaviorを実装してみる. WPFのBehaviorってなんかやること多いしXaml側には ~... みたいなよくわからん名前空間がネストしてあるしで何となく敬遠していたのでちゃんと調べました。. あとMVVM的に書きたいけどマウスイベントトリガーでアクションさ ... how to drink recipesWebMar 18, 2024 · Contents. 画面遷移の基本. 画面が2つの場合. STEP1 - 次の画面に遷移する. STEP2 - 前の画面に遷移する. 画面が3つ以上の場合. STEP1 - main.dartにルートを作成する. STEP2 - 移動したい画面に遷移する. まとめ. how to drink oolong tea for weight loss